				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Watch Dogs has sold over 63,000 copies on its debut in the land of the rising sun, and helped inch ever so slightly upwards the sales of PS4 consoles there.<span id="more-89530"></span></p>
<p>According to Media Create, the game sold approximately 63,595 copies sold on PS4, and 31,028 copies on PS3. PS4 console sales jumped from 7,009 to 8,059 units.</p>
<p>Sony Japan Studio&#8217;s Freedom Wars was the week&#8217;s biggest seller, moving 188,888 copies and helping PS Vita hardware sales jump over 10,000 units to 24,919. 3DS holds at No.1 with 27,884 units.</p>
<p>Wii U hardware sales dropped slightly to 10,653 units.</p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Ubisoft&#8217;s new IP which saw its launch last week around the world, is now the UK&#8217;s biggest new IP launch of all time, besting the former record holder, L.A. Noire, by more than 57 percent. The hacking, open-world game even topped Ubisoft&#8217;s former record holder, Assassin&#8217;s Creed 3 by 17 percent.<span id="more-89193"></span></p>
<p>As for software sales breakdown, the majority of sales came from the PS4 version &#8212; 54 percent, which includes bundles, and the game also helped in lifting PS4 hardware sales by 94 percent. Xbox One took 27 percent of the sales, Xbox 360 13 percent, and PS3 9 percent.</p>
<p>Elsewhere Mario Kart 8 came in solidly at #2, becoming the Wii U&#8217;s biggest launch of all time, and the second bestselling Mario Kart title. The game also helped propel Wii U hardware sales by a staggering 666 percent.</p>
<p>In third place we have last week&#8217;s number 1 Wolfenstein: New Order, FIFA 14 in 4th, and Mincraft: PS3 Edition in 5th.</p>

<p><strong>Exclusive Content Details:</strong></p>
<p><em>Today, Ubisoft and Sony Computer Entertainment Europe announced that Watch Dogs, the highly anticipated open world action adventure title, will offer additional content only available on PlayStation 4 and PlayStation 3.</em></p>
<p><em>The exclusive content includes four extra missions, representing one hour of exclusive gameplay, as well as a unique ‘White Hat’ Hacker Outfit. By playing this additional content, players will have a deeper knowledge of DedSec, a key and powerful faction in the Watch Dogs universe. Once complete, a Hacking Boost named Superior Capacity is acquired which gives players one additional Battery Slot.</em></p>
<p><em>The scenario takes place after Aiden Pearce, the vigilante hero of Watch Dogs, catches the eye of DedSec, a notorious hacker group fighting for freedom and security in the digital age. Aiden receives an encoded message asking him to help some members of this organization who want payback. Pearce must use his knowledge of Chicago’s complex ctOS network to discover digital vulnerabilities in Umeni Technologies’ security network and earn his reward.</em></p>
<p><em>We are pleased to also announce that Watch Dogs bundles for both PS4 and PS3 will be available for launch in Europe, which include all of the Sony exclusive content.</em></p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>This is high level trolling, people. Apparently someone fraudulently asked the USPTO to fast track the cancellation of Ubisoft&#8217;s &#8216;Watch Dogs&#8217; patent, sending the internet into a tailspin of discussion, with many wondering whether the game had been cancelled or was facing the same.<span id="more-74486"></span></p>
<p>No, it absolutely hasn&#8217;t been cancelled. In fact refinement of the game continues, but behind the scene Ubisoft has been frantically trying to get the attention of the USPTO to inform them that the request was not done by Ubisoft, and that they should not honor the request. <em>Weird stuff, eh? </em></p>
<p data-textannotation-id="caf1b397b330d8c6f3a32c98a0d9a6a8">Here&#8217;s the notice the publisher sent to the USPTO earlier today (emphasis added):</p>
<blockquote data-textannotation-id="caa8636fd7e6859c065e66c11b62e2bd"><p>Ubisoft Entertainment submits this Petition to the Director under Trademark Rule 2.146 to prevent the abandonment of Application Serial No. 85642398. <strong>A fraudulent Request for Express Abandonment was recently filed in connection with Application Serial No. 85642398</strong>.</p>
<p><span style="text-decoration: underline;">Facts</span></p>
<p>On February 1, 2014, Ubisoft Entertainment received an email from<a href="mailto:TEAS@uspto.gov">TEAS@uspto.gov</a> notifying Ubisoft Entertainment that a Request for Express Abandonment had been filed in connection with Application Serial No. 85642398. The Request for Express Abandonment purports to be signed by the Chief Executive Officer of Ubisoft Entertainment, Yves Guillemot.</p>
<p><strong>Mr. Guillemot, however, did not sign the Request for Express Abandonment, nor did Ubisoft Entertainment file the Request for Express Abandonment</strong>. The Request for Express Abandonment is fraudulent and was not filed by Ubisoft Entertainment or its representative.</p></blockquote>
<p data-textannotation-id="a1131d12445fef4f0b852c8ad7a834b7">Ubisoft says &#8220;We are working directly with the USPTO on reinstating the trademark for Watch Dogs and it will be active again in the coming days. The matter has no impact on the Watch Dogs&#8217; development.&#8221;</p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h4>Ubisoft has announced that its highly-anticipated open-world, hacking title, has been delayed into 2014.<div class="clear"></div><div class="divider"></div><span id="more-65399"></span></h4>
<p>&#8220;Our ambition from the start with <em>Watch Dogs</em> has been to deliver something that embodies what we wanted to see in the next-generation of gaming,&#8221; Ubisoft wrote. &#8220;It is with this in mind that we’ve made the tough decision to delay the release until spring 2014.&#8221;</p>
<p>The game was originally slated for a November release on PS3, Xbox 360, Wii U, PS4 and Xbox One.</p>
<p data-textannotation-id="ebbf7913a2fd229c97d8b1880ce44421">&#8220;We know a lot of you are probably wondering: Why now?&#8221; Ubisoft wrote. &#8220;We struggled with whether we would delay the game. But from the beginning, we have adopted the attitude that we will not compromise on quality. As we got closer to release, as all the pieces of the puzzle were falling into place in our last push before completion, it became clear to us that we needed to take the extra time to polish and fine tune each detail so we can deliver a truly memorable and exceptional experience.</p>
<p data-textannotation-id="ab24e9417c54157fffef2411a440bbdd">&#8220;We would like to take this opportunity to thank all of you. We thoroughly enjoy and appreciate the way you respond on the web, at events, press conferences and other opportunities we have to interact. Your passion keeps us motivated.</p>
<p data-textannotation-id="95b92b3d6c7ee37f3c4f4e1eb76f43e3">&#8220;We can’t wait to see you in Chicago next spring. We are confident you’ll love this game as much as we love working on it.&#8221;</p>
<p data-textannotation-id="95b92b3d6c7ee37f3c4f4e1eb76f43e3">Meanwhile, tens or thousands &#8211; and probably even more gamers had already preordered their next-gen consoles with Watch Dogs bundled, BUT Ubisoft didn&#8217;t explain how exactly it planned on sorting the situation. Sony, however, said that it was working with Ubisoft to resolve the problem.</p>
<p data-textannotation-id="95b92b3d6c7ee37f3c4f4e1eb76f43e3">&#8220;Obviously this is [a] very recent announcement, but we will be working very closely both with Ubisoft and with our partners at retail to manage this situation,&#8221; SCEE said.</p>
<p data-textannotation-id="95b92b3d6c7ee37f3c4f4e1eb76f43e3">Ubisoft also announced the delay of The Crew into 2014.</p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Ubisoft expects their newest, exciting-looking IP Watch Dogs to surpass the 6.2m sales of the original Assassin&#8217;s Creed, which launched in November 2007. Discussing the game during its Q1 FY13-14 earnings call last night, Ubisoft explained that it had increased its expectations for the new IP following a positive reception at last month&#8217;s E3.</p>
<p>&#8220;What is true is that three months ago when we announced our result we were referencing in our plan we had billed up Watch Dogs with expectations slightly below what Assassin&#8217;s Creed 1 did when it was first released, [which] was 6.2m. So after E3, what we&#8217;ve said today was that we do feel that we can expect &#8211; or that&#8217;s what we have billed in our expectation &#8211; slightly above the 6.2m that Assassin&#8217;s Creed did.&#8221;</p>
<p>The game goes on sale on Xbox 360, PlayStation 3, PC and Wii U on November 22, 2013, with planned Playstation 4 and Xbox One versions on their way.</p>

<p><strong>The Secrets Behind Watch Dogs’ Next Gen Experience</strong></p>
<p>Building an open-world game ain’t easy. Without a strong foundation, everything can quickly collapse. In the case of Watch Dogs that foundation is the Disrupt engine, the product of over four years of dedication and tests and trials. In that time Ubisoft Montreal has built an engine that’s both flexible and efficient, while allowing for an astounding level of detail and a seamlessly online environment.</p>
<p>Senior Producer Dominic Guay breaks down this awe-inspiring engine into three parts: dynamism, impact on the city, and connectivity. And because the Disrupt engine was built specifically to power Watch Dogs, we also uncovered a healthy helping of new gameplay details to go along with all the tantalizing tech talk.</p>
<span class="highlight">Dynamism</span>
<p>The surface layer of the Disrupt engine is focused on what Guay describes as “dynamism,” or the simulation systems within the game: “In our city we simulate the way people drive cars. The electricity is simulated. The water is simulated. The wind is simulated. Everything reacts to everything. Making all those systems talk to one another is where you get branching reactions.”</p>
<p>Take the rain, for example. When the sky starts to open up, civilians will pull out umbrellas. The lights reflect off wet surfaces. We can see the wind shifting the direction of the rain and blowing debris around. Even leaves and trash on the ground will begin to appear damp and weighted down by moisture. These small but significant details lend an unparalleled level of immersion to Watch Dogs.</p>
<p>Even the clothing comes to life in Watch Dogs. It boggles the mind to think about just how long was spent getting the simple act of Aiden putting his hands in his pockets to look just right. The wind pulling at a passerby’s clothing will cause them to tighten their jackets. “Everyone on the street should have clothing simulation,” Guay says. “We want to see it blow in the wind and move with them.”</p>
<p>These are merely the “details,” though. Something major like a car crash will create a widespread ripple effect. Civilians will get caught up in a traffic jam and start honking or even leave their cars to investigate. Others will be injured in the wreck. Onlookers will alert emergency response teams. It all combines to offer an unprecedented amount of realism in a videogame.</p>
<span class="highlight">Impact</span>
<p>As important as those details are, a game isn’t made with raindrops and dynamically generated bullet holes alone. Also important are the ways in which a player can affect the entire city, primarily noticeable through its residents. While there’s no simplistic back-and-white morality system in Watch Dogs, Aiden’s actions will trigger reactions from the game’s NPCs. We got the breakdown from Animation Director Colin Graham: “The reputation system isn’t a good or evil meter. It’s actually the perception people have of your actions. It completely affects how the city will react to you. If you run around just taking everybody out and killing tons of people, the citizens are going to think you’re kind of a jerk and they’re going to call the cops every time you do something wrong. You’re going to get spotted by the media more.”</p>
<p>In other words, should you choose to play the game in a more openly violent fashion – gun constantly in hand, killing indiscriminately in front of civilians – the people of Chicago will be more liable to turn on you. They will call the police when they see you, and your face will wind up on the news a lot more often. “We think it’s much more empowering to the player if he feels like he has made an impact on the city,” Guay elaborates. “We want him to make his own decisions instead of us forcing decisions on him.”</p>
<span class="highlight">Connectivity</span>
<p>In Watch Dogs, you can go from being connected and online with other players to being fully disconnected – without affecting the world or changing the environment. That’s no small feat, and this seamless connectivity is another key pillar of the Disrupt engine. “There’s no loading or matchmaking or waiting for a game to start,” Guay says. “That means that every single thing in the game needed to be ready to be synchronized with the network. Every aspect of animation and physics and the AI needed to work online with other players.”</p>
<p>But don’t worry about thousands of stalkers, hackers and griefers ruining your day. When you’re in your game, you won’t see other players just running around wreaking havoc. That would diminish the immersion Disrupt works so hard to build. The only time another player will actually enter your world is when they accept a contract with your name on it. From there they can creep through your city streets, stalking you until they decide to strike. They will appear to you as any other Chicagoan, just like you would appear nondescript to them should you invade their game. There will never be two Aidens on the screen.</p>
<p>Though the engine is built with this connectivity in mind, it can be turned off for players who prefer to explore unhindered by any outside influences. The multiplayer will also be unavailable during story missions, so you don’t need to worry about hackers while you’re in the middle of an important moment.</p>
<span class="highlight">Flexibility</span>
<p>We know not everyone will be rushing out to buy the new PS4 or Xbox One right away and that’s totally okay. Enter the “fourth pillar” of Disrupt: The engine was built for next-gen, but it’s flexible enough to allow owners of current-gen systems to still get an amazing experience. “We knew we would have next-gen hardware coming out before we ship,” Guay says. “But we started off knowing we wanted to support PS3 and Xbox 360.” The trick is in knowing how to scale things appropriately for both console generations. This allows designers to keep the overall experience the same. “On current-gen systems we may need to cut down the number of people on the street a little, but it’s still the same game. You don’t get the same sense of the crowd, but it allows us to scale certain bits and keep the same experience.”</p>
<p>Graham illuminates the graphical differences: “Players are going to know they aren’t getting a bad experience if they play Watch Dogs for the current gen, but the next gen is the real HD experience. You can zoom in another level. You can have better shaders, better simulation on the wind or the water, more particles, better atmospherics… Basically anything you can get with more computing power.”</p>
<p>So have no fear if you plan on playing Watch Dogs on the PS3 or 360. There are no trimmed-down mechanics to make you feel as though you are missing out on the core experience. Watch Dogs is truly a next-gen game – not just in terms of offering cutting edge graphical performance on the next generation of consoles, but also when it comes to the gameplay, the immersion and the seamless online experience. And that’s due in large part to a great foundation: the Disrupt Engine.</p>

<p><em>In Watch Dogs, the highly anticipated open world action game from Ubisoft, the fictionalized city of Chicago is run by a Central Operating System, linking all of the city’s online infrastructures and public security installations to one centralized hub. Information is at the heart of the game and also at the heart of WeareData.</em></p>
<p><em>With WeareData, visitors will discover that much of the hyper-connected world imagined in Watch Dogs already is a reality, and that everything and everyone is truly connected. The amount of and potential uses for public and personal information that is readily available online has never been more relevant, as evidenced by today’s headlines. WeareData is designed to provide a glimpse into this reality and to give visitors a new perspective on the cities in which they live.</em></p>
<p><em>Watch Dogs&#8217; WeareData allows users to access the real-time data that organize and help run the cities of Berlin, London and Paris, as well current information on their inhabitants. Via a 3D mapping system, the consolidated, openly available information that can be easily viewed includes public transport schedules such as subways and public bicycles, telecommunications networks including mobile antennas, WiFi spots and advertising networks, energy consumption, traffic and safety infrastructure like CCTV cameras and traffic lights and regionalized socioeconomic data such as average net income, unemployment rate and crime rate. Also available are geo-localized social media activities for the cities’ residents, including their public posts on Facebook, Foursquare, Instagram and Twitter.</em></p>
